One of last year’s New Artist to Radio (NA2R) winners, Danielle Blakey, has won Gold in the inaugural ABU Radio Song Festival. Danielle was entered by Commercial Radio Australia and beat 14 other unsigned acts from around the Asia Pacific region to win the inaugural event.
Chief executive officer of Commercial Radio Australia, Joan Warner said "The ABU Radio Song Festival is in its first year of operation and aims to promote unsigned original music across Asia and the Pacific. Danielle performed in Seoul, Korea in conjunction with the ABU General Assembly. It was a glittering occasion and is sure to open doors to a broader international audience," .
